Review#
Let’s recap the key points we’ve covered about Isaac ROS:
ROS#
The Robot Operating System (ROS) is a set of open-source software libraries and tools created to build robot applications.
NVIDIA is committed to supporting the ROS community, bringing accelerated computing, generative AI and simulation advances to ROS developers worldwide. NVIDIA is a supporter of Open Robotics, the umbrella organization for OSRF and all its initiatives including ROS.
Isaac ROS#
NVIDIA Isaac ROS is a collection of NVIDIA CUDA-accelerated computing packages and AI models designed to streamline and expedite the development of advanced AI robotics applications.
Isaac ROS gives you a powerful toolkit for building robotic applications. It offers ready-to-use packages for common tasks like navigation and perception, uses NVIDIA frameworks for optimal performance, and can be deployed on both workstations and embedded systems like NVIDIA Jetson™.
We also provide reference workflows for Isaac ROS that can serve as starting points for users to build upon for their specific needs.
NITROS#
The NVIDIA Isaac Transport for ROS (NITROS) is a key technology developed by NVIDIA. ROS 2 graphs using NITROS-based, NVIDIA-accelerated Isaac ROS packages can significantly increase performance.